Minister Magar vows to conserve ponds, water spouts in Valley



KATHMANDU: Minister for Water Supply Bina Magar has said plans would be made to conserve, promote and beautify ponds, lakes and stone water spouts within Kathmandu Valley.

Inaugurating a book published by Kathmandu Valley Water Supply Management Board on old ponds and water spouts in the Valley, Minister Magar stressed on the need of conversing ponds and stone water spouts.

“Ponds and water spouts are bearing the brunt of modernization and urbanization,” she said, emphasizing the need to conserve them.

She was of the opinion that traditional ponds and water spouts can become a major touristic destination.

The book was published after carrying out a detailed study of ponds and water spouts in 10 municipalities of Kathmandu Valley.
